A winning business strategy is built on a solid foundation of research, analysis, and planning. It begins with a deep understanding of the company's mission, vision, and values. The strategy should be aligned with the company's overall goals and objectives, taking into account internal and external factors that may impact its success. Any business, regardless of size, can benefit from a well-crafted strategy.
Yes, a small business can develop a winning business strategy. In fact, having a solid strategy can be even more crucial for small businesses, which often have limited resources and must be agile to adapt to changing market conditions.

In the United States, businesses are facing unprecedented challenges, from economic uncertainty to increasing competition. As a result, entrepreneurs and executives are turning to strategic planning as a way to mitigate risks and capitalize on opportunities. A winning business strategy enables companies to adapt to changing market conditions, stay focused on their goals, and make informed decisions that drive results. With the US business landscape becoming increasingly complex, the demand for effective business strategies is on the rise.
